‘NCIS: Sydney’ Renewed for Season 2 by CBS and Paramount+

CBS and Paramount+ have officially renewed NCIS: Sydney for a second season, following its successful debut last November. The series stars Olivia Swann as NCIS Special Agent Michelle Mackey and showcases a joint task force with the Australian Federal Police tackling cases involving Americans abroad.

Created by Morgan O’Neill, NCIS: Sydney also features Todd Lasance as AFP agent JD Dempsey, Tuuli Narkle as Evie Cooper, and Mavournee Hazel as forensic scientist Blue Gleeson. The show quickly became a critical and streaming hit, ranking as CBS’s top-rated new series last fall with over 8 million viewers per episode across multiple platforms.

O’Neill is eager to explore the characters’ stories further in Season 2, promising even more intense action and new challenges for the team.

The series is part of the expanding NCIS franchise, which includes upcoming spin-offs like a prequel featuring Mark Harmon’s Gibbs and a series reuniting Ziva and DiNozzo.
